Grant funding boost for exporters through the recognition of professional qualifications

Yesterday (3rd August) the government announced the launch of The Recognition Arrangements Grants Programme which will provide grants of up to £75,000 to help regulators seek mutual recognition of professional qualifications.


The grant is aimed at UK regulators to help them acquire the staff and

consultants they need to develop recognition arrangements with international counterparts which will ensure British professionals have their qualifications recognised overseas.


Mutual recognition of qualifications can help lawyers, accountants, engineers and others to access new opportunities abroad without the need to requalify with additional qualifications.


The UK is already the second largest exporter of services in the world and the government hopes that this new funding will provide an additional boost to our trade in services.
